我有一个Firebase新手问题:在iOS应用程序中集成Firebase时,我被要求使用Analytics'_anonymizeIp()来自Firebase对象。这可能还是概念上无效?任何提示表示赞赏。最好的问候,马库斯 最佳答案 IP地址目前由FirebaseAnalytics匿名处理。没有必要/方法明确地这样做。但是,没有任何东西可以保证我们在Firebase的APIdesign中将这些匿名化或termsofservice.鉴于这只是一个实现细节,如果您试图依赖它来满足任何类型的法律合规性或满足您公司的隐私政策,您应该小心。文档
Apple最近发布了iOS8.3。他们添加了更多的表情符号,现在所有表情符号都在移动浏览器中呈现。例如▶将呈现为表情符号图标。有没有办法禁用表情符号渲染?例如通过CSS或JavaScript? 最佳答案 是的,您可以通过使用适当的变体字形逐个字符地禁用这些。由于未指定变体,以下示例将黑色的右指三Angular形呈现为表情符号。▶但是,如果您指定了正确的变体字形,您将获得文本。▶︎一般来说,︎为您提供文本版本,而️或未另行指定的为您提供表情符号版本。参见http://anthonytickno
我有一系列打开弹出窗口的页面(MobileSafari中的新选项卡)。这些弹出窗口中的每一个都需要知道它们何时获得焦点。在台式机上,我们使用window.onblur和window.onfocus来驱动此行为。但是,这些事件均不适用于iPad。我还尝试了window.onpageshow和window.onpagehide,它们似乎也没有在正确的时间触发。我有一个测试HTML文件:console.log('Hello');window.onblur=function(e){console.log('blur');};window.onfocus=function(e){console.
我在iPadSafari上安装了jQueryMobile,出于某种原因,触摸滑动事件触发了两次。人们在过去的一年中最近就在本周报告了同样的问题,但我找不到如何在不修改jQueryMobile的情况下修复双重事件的解释,我不想那样做。ThreadonjQueryforums滑动处理程序的以下元素绑定(bind)都具有相同的错误双事件结果,其中每次滑动都会调用两次警报。应该如何绑定(bind)jQueryMobile触摸事件以避免双重冒泡?//Test1:Bindingdirectlytodocumentwithdelegate()$(document).delegate(document
我目前正在我的Windows机器上使用MarmaladeSDK来构建应用程序。我正在尝试在iPhone上测试该应用程序,并为此下载了iPhone配置实用程序。但是,每当我启动它时,都会收到以下错误:iPhone配置实用程序无法找到“AppleMobileDeviceSupport”。请重新安装iPhone配置实用程序。您可以从http://www.apple.com/support/iphone/enterprise下载iPhone配置实用程序。但是,即使我重新安装它,我仍然会收到同样的错误。任何帮助将不胜感激! 最佳答案 我遇到了
通过cocoapod安装SocketMobileScanApiSdk后,我无法再在真实设备上运行。我注意到sdk包含“资源”组。但是即使重命名并删除“资源”组后,我也无法在真实设备上运行该项目。我在Xcode7.3.1上使用“scanapisdk-10-3-412”并尝试在ipadAir2上运行。 最佳答案 我发布答案是为了以防其他人将来遇到同样的问题。正如我在原始问题中评论的那样。此问题已通过删除项目目标名称中的空格来解决(例如,示例项目->示例项目)。我不确定导致问题的真正原因是什么。然而,在我重新命名我的项目目标后,我不再遇到
如何使用FireMonkey在Android或iOS中以从右到左的语言(例如波斯语或阿拉伯语)显示任何字符串?我使用EmbarcaderoRadStudioXE6(Delphi),当我放置TLabel或TEdit并将其文本设置为“سلام”(波斯语中的你好)时,在Windows和Mac中一切正常,但在移动平台中显示错误,在Android显示“مالس”,而在iOS中只显示空格。问题在DelphiXE7中依然存在。 最佳答案 Firemonkey本身不支持从右到左的文本呈现。为此,您将不得不使用第三方库。最好的选择之一是Skia4De
我有一个包含元数据的网络应用在iOS11.3之前,当“添加到主屏幕”时,它会像没有导航栏的独立应用程序一样打开。在11.3之后,它现在会在浏览器中打开导航栏。 最佳答案 经过数小时的故障排除后,我发现以下内容可能对其他人有所帮助。为了Android/Chrome兼容性,我的html文件中已经包含以下内容:manifest.json没有"display":"standalone"条目,它只是定义了图标和名称。似乎在11.3之前该文件被safari忽略,但现在它被考虑并优先于元标记apple-mobile-web-app-capable
这是否违反了Apple应用开发规则?在某些论坛上,我刚刚看到了那个东西。所以害怕如果我使用相同的应用程序商店被拒绝。请帮助我。如果我不能使用GoogleAnalyticsSDK,那么我可以为我的应用程序实现哪种最佳分析方法? 最佳答案 这不是法律建议,但截至目前,Apple尚未拒绝任何使用GoogleAnalytics的应用。Google已发布官方iOSGoogleAnalyticsSDK,并且没有Apple明确禁止或劝阻其使用的记录。GoogleAnalytics(分析)是周围使用最广泛的分析解决方案,除非您的运营总部位于德国以外
背景:我有一个下拉菜单,基本上与thisotherMobileSafariEventIssuequestion中描述的相同。:单击菜单项以显示下拉菜单,再次单击菜单项或单击页面上的其他任何位置以隐藏菜单。隐藏下拉列表的jQuery绑定(bind)到父级的点击事件跨越整个窗口。此下拉菜单在所有浏览器(包括MobileSafari)中都可以正常工作,我在这里描述它只是为了上下文。问题:此onclick事件会阻止MobileSafari上的用户(在iPodTouch4.2.1和iPad4.3.5上测试)获得正常的触摸和按住Copy|将弹出窗口粘贴到我们网站的任何位置。哦!根据我的研究,似乎如